Obuh says Kwara Utd will strengthen squad ahead of NNL second round

Date: 2016-07-10

Technical Adviser of Kwara United Football Club, John Obuh, says he will be strengthening his squad ahead of the crucial second round of the 2015/2016 Nigeria National League (NNL).

The club's Media Officer, Jimoh Bashir, in a statement Saturday in Ilorin quoted Obuh as saying the league's second round was going to be crucial and a drastic move was needed. The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ports that Obuh said this after the "Harmony Boys" forced FC Zamfara to a 1-1 draw in Gusau in an NNL week seven match.

The coach who was appraising the team's performance in the first round however commended the Kwara State Government and the state's Ministry of Sports for their support which made them excel. "Equally, the team's management, players and other officials, as well as the fans, Supporters Club and other stakeholders deserve praise for their support."

He however reminded all concerned that there was still more work to be done to achieve the set objective. "Our set objective is returning at the end of this season to the Nigeria Professional Football League (NPFL), and there is still a lot to do to get there. So, we must ensure all hands are on deck for this."

Bashir, in the statement, reported that Kwara United started the game well, keeping the home side at bay and forcing host goalkeeper Nura Mohammed to make some good saves. The pressure on FC Zamfara yielded result in the 24th minute, when Yusuf Abubakar's cross was diverted into the net by Segun Alebiosu.

"The goal might have woken up FC Zamfara from their slumber, as they pushed hard for the equaliser, relying much on their fans' harassment of Kwara United FC. "For example, the fans ran into the pitch immediately after the half time whistle.

"hey held the match officials and our players and officials hostage for close to 40 minutes, thus delaying the resumption of the second half by 24 minutes. "But the pressure and harassment reduced a bit after they got the equaliser just three minutes into the second half.

"hereafter, the two teams struggled to get the winning goal without success, with goalkeeper Ismaila Shagari's brilliance making the difference for us," Bashir said in the statement. NAN reports that, with the draw, Kwara United now have 14 points from seven matches as the first round of the abridged 2015/2016 NNL ends.

NAN also reports that the match was played at the Sardauna Memorial Stadium in Gusau.(NAN)
